To change the language in a Xatab repack—which typically defaults to Russian—you usually need to modify the game's internal configuration files or the Windows Registry. 1. Configuration File Edit (Most Common)
Most repacks use an emulator (like Steam-Emu or Goldberg) to run. Look for a configuration file in the game's root folder or the \bin subfolder:
Locate the File: Look for files named steam_api.ini, steam_emu.ini, context.ini, or settings.txt.
Edit the Value: Open the file with Notepad. Find the line that says Language=russian and change it to Language=english.
Save: Save the file (you may need to run Notepad as Administrator) and restart the game. 2. Registry Editor Method
If no config file is found, the game may pull its language setting from Windows: Press Win + R, type regedit, and hit Enter.
Navigate to: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\[Game Name or Publisher]. Look for a string value named Language or Locale.
Double-click it and change the value to English, en-US, or en. 3. Re-Installation Setup
Xatab installers often include a language toggle during the installation process itself.
Russian Prompt: In many cases, the installer is in Russian. Look for a checkbox or dropdown menu that mentions "Язык интерфейса" (Interface Language) and ensure "English" is selected before clicking install.
Selective Download: Ensure you didn't uncheck "English files" or "English VO" if you downloaded the repack via torrent. 4. In-Game Settings
While less common for these specific repacks, check the in-game "Settings" or "Options" menu. Look for "Настройки" (Settings) -> "Язык" (Language).
Note: If the repack only includes Russian files (often labeled as "Russian Only"), you will need to download an English Language Pack separately and place it in the game's installation directory.

Changing the language in Xatab repack games usually involves a few simple steps, but the "best" method depends on whether the game uses an external launcher or an internal configuration file. Since Xatab repacks are essentially compressed versions of original game files, they typically include a Language Selector tool or a specific .ini file where these settings are stored. 1. Using the Integrated Language Selector
Most modern Xatab repacks come with a dedicated executable file specifically for language settings.
Locate the Folder: Open the main installation directory where you installed the game.
Find the Tool: Look for an application named Language Selector.exe, Lang.exe, or Change Language.exe.
Run and Save: Open the tool, select your preferred language (e.g., English) from the dropdown menu, and click Save or OK. 2. Editing the Configuration (.ini) File
If there is no executable tool, the language is likely controlled by a configuration file. This is often the most reliable "better" way to ensure the change sticks.
Find the File: Look for files named steam_emu.ini, context.ini, or settings.ini in the game's main folder or the bin folder.
Open with Notepad: Right-click the file and select Open with Notepad.
Modify the Language Line: Search for a line that says Language=russian or Language=ru_RU.
Change to English: Edit it to read Language=english or Language=en_US. Save: Save the file and restart the game. 3. Checking In-Game Settings
While Xatab repacks often default to the language of the installer, many high-profile titles allow you to change the interface and audio separately within the game's own "Options" or "Settings" menu. Navigate to Settings > Audio/Language.
Ensure both "Text Language" and "Voice Language" are set to your preference. 4. Re-running the Installer (Last Resort) Note: If you intended “Xatab” as a personal
If the game files for a specific language weren't selected during the initial setup, the files simply won't exist on your hard drive. Run the setup.exe again.
During the component selection screen, ensure the English (or preferred language) checkbox is ticked.
You may need to reinstall the game to "unlock" those specific language packs. Why "Xatab" Methods Matter
